首页|基于虚实映射的电力物联网架构研究

基于虚实映射的电力物联网架构研究

随着电力系统向数字化、智能化转型,数字孪生技术在电力领域应用日益广泛.而电力物联网作为数字孪生的关键技术基础,需要在精细采集、高效传输、安全存储等方面取得进展.文章探讨了面向数字孪生的电力物联网技术发展方向,分析了其面临的科学问题,提出了其技术架构,研究了其使用的关键技术,对推进电网数字化升级,实现电网向能源互联网的转型具有重要意义.
Research on the Architecture of Power Internet of Things Based on Virtual Real Mapping
With the transformation of power system to digitalization and intelligence,digital twin technology has been widely used in power field.The power Internet of Things,as the key technical basis of the digital twin,needs to make progress in fine collection,efficient transmission,and secure storage.This paper discusses the development direction of power iot technology for digital twin,analyzes the scientific problems it faces,puts forward its technical framework,and studies the key technologies it uses,which is of great significance for promoting the digital upgrade of power grid and realizing the transformation of power grid to energy Internet.
